This course focuses on understanding basic termite biology and characteristics in order to apply treatments, locate infestations, and problem solve challenging treatment situations. Labels are reviewed to help ensure applicators are exposed to different labels and how product information is conveyed for treatments.
Sample treatments are outlined using various products as examples to help in measuring the proper amount to use for treatments.
Tools and methods for drywood and subterranean termites are covered and reviewed to keep the applicator, environment and structure as less exposed to termiticides as possible.
This course is approved by the FDACS for a maximum of 2 Hours of CEU for the following Categories: Limited Certification Structural Pest Control, and Wood Destroying Organisms or for 4 CEU Hours for the Wood Treatment Category. The course is online and available in both English and Spanish.
